Day 1C in the Books

Level 11 : 600/1,200, 200 ante

The third and final starting flight of the Poker King Cup Macau Main Event is now done and dusted and players are in the midst of bagging up their chips.

At one point it looked like India's Bobbie Suri would be the runaway chip leader as he had 210,000 at the close of level 10, but took a few hits in the last level, finishing the day with 161,300. That means the man who finished the day with the largest stack is Singapore's Yah Loon Lim who bagged up a very respectable 177,300.
